site stats

Binary recursion python

WebBinary Search using Recursion in Python We split a collection of items into two halves in Binary Search to decrease the number of direct comparisons needed to discover an element. However, there's one requirement: the array's items must be sorted beforehand. Binary Search The Binary Search Method locates the index of a certain list member. Web20 hours ago · Using recursion, I am asked to create a method for removing the smallest element of a BST in Python. I cannot use the already implemented function remove. Have tried several times with similar codes, even copying and editing the remove function. However, the smallest node it is not removed. Can anyone help me with this?

How to write python recursive generator and iterator

WebPython Download Run Code Iterative Implementation To convert the above recursive procedure into an iterative one, we need an explicit stack. Following is a simple stack-based iterative algorithm to perform preorder traversal: iterativePreorder (node) if (node = null) return s —> empty stack s.push (node) while (not s.isEmpty ()) node —> s.pop () WebAll Algorithms implemented in Python. Contribute to saitejamanchi/TheAlgorithms-Python development by creating an account on GitHub. on the way to school summary https://southwestribcentre.com

Recursive Functions in Python - Towards Data Science

WebPython Program to Convert Decimal to Binary Using Recursion. In this program, you will learn to convert decimal number to binary using recursive function. To understand this example, you should have the knowledge of … WebJul 26, 2024 · 1. Representation of the binary tree structure: A binary tree is a data structure formed by a hierarchy of elements called nodes. A node is characterized by two categories of information: Node-specific … WebAug 18, 2024 · Representing Binary Trees using Python classes We can create a class to represent each node in a tree, along with its left and right children. Using the root node object, we can parse the whole tree. We will also define a … on the way to the airport netflix

Python All Permutations of a string in lexicographical order …

Category:TheAlgorithms-Python/decimal_to_binary_recursion.py at master ...

Tags:Binary recursion python

Binary recursion python

Binary search in python using recursion StudyMite

WebMar 12, 2024 · Recursive Approach: The idea is to traverse the tree in a Level Order manner but in a slightly different manner. We will use a variable flag and initially set it’s value to zero. As we complete the level order traversal of the tree, from right to left we will set the value of flag to one, so that next time we can traverse the Tree from left ... WebJul 26, 2024 · Recursive Functions in Python With examples from the world of Data Science Photo by Tine Ivanič on Unsplash Table of contents What’s Recursion? Recursion in Programmation Examples from the …

Binary recursion python

Did you know?

Web2 days ago · Here is a simple test for binary tree and it worked correctly. myset = BinaryTree () for item in (2,1,3,5): myset.insert (item) myset.printnode () for item in myset: print (item) python recursion generator Share Follow asked 2 mins ago wangjianyu 35 3 Add a comment 2092 3106 Know someone who can answer? WebMay 8, 2024 · Hence, height of the binary tree is 4. Algorithm for Calculating Height of a Binary Tree. There are two methods to approach this problem statement. First Approach is based on Depth first seach using recursion, and the other method is based on Breadth first search using Level order traversal without using recursion.

WebMar 13, 2024 · Python Program to Implement Binary Search with Recursion. When it is required to implement binary search using recursion, a method can be defined, that … WebMay 8, 2024 · Let us consider the following binary tree: Now according to the inorder tree traversal method in python, we first traverse the left subtree of the original tree. …

WebThe given code defines a recursive function convert(), which needs to convert its argument from decimal to binary. However, the code has an error. Fix the code by adding the base case for the recursion, then take a number from user input and call the convert() function, to output the result. 8 Sample Output: 1000 def convert(num): WebYou can implement binary search in python in the following way. def binary_search_recursive(list_of_numbers, number, start=0, end=None): # The end …

WebUse the bisect module to do a binary search in Python Implement a binary search in Python both recursively and iteratively Recognize and fix defects in a binary search Python implementation Analyze the time-space …

WebPython Recursion (Recursive Function) Python Recursion In this tutorial, you will learn to create a recursive function (a function that calls itself). Recursion is the process of defining something in terms of itself. A … on the way to the futureWebAll Algorithms implemented in Python. Contribute to saitejamanchi/TheAlgorithms-Python development by creating an account on GitHub. on the way to school作文WebJul 11, 2024 · Python Sort list of lists by lexicographic value and then length; Sort the words in lexicographical order in Python; Python All Permutations of a string in … on the way to school netflixWebFor traversing a (non-empty) binary tree in a postorder fashion, we must do these three things for every node nstarting from the tree’s root: (L)Recursively traverse its left subtree. When this step is finished, we are back at nagain. (R)Recursively traverse its right subtree. When this step is finished, we are back at nagain. (N)Process nitself. on the way to st ives riddleWebFeb 2, 2024 · In order to split the predictor space into distinct regions, we use binary recursive splitting, which grows our decision tree until we reach a stopping criterion. Since we need a reasonable way to decide which splits are useful and which are not, we also need a metric for evaluation purposes. ios hacks appsWebOct 31, 2024 · Convert Decimal to binary with Recursion Data Structures & Algorithms Python nETSETOS 11.4K subscribers Subscribe 20K views 3 years ago Recursion With Python Data Structures &... ios hacking softwareWebBinary Search in Python (Recursive and Iterative) There are different types of searches in data structures. Today we are going to learn about the Binary Search Algorithm, it’s … on the way to the beach